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Ferryside to Llanhilleth start from as little as £10.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ferryside to Llanhilleth are available for £27.70 one way, or £30.60 return

Station Facilities

Ferryside station embodies simplicity, offering basic amenities without the complexity of larger stations. There is no ticket office, so travelers must plan ahead and purchase tickets online or through mobile apps before arrival, as there are no ticket machines available for collection. Despite the lack of extensive facilities, you'll find an induction loop available, ensuring those with hearing impairments can travel with ease.

Accessibility at Ferryside

Accessibility features at Ferryside make the journey possible for everyone. Step-free access is granted to Platform 1, bound for Swansea, from the car park. Meanwhile, access to Platform 2, heading towards Carmarthen, is reachable via a level crossing, with both platforms interconnected by a footbridge. These thoughtful inclusions cater to the mobility needs of passengers, though it's important to note there are no on-site wheelchairs or accessible taxis.

Onward Travel Connections

Traveling from Ferryside is more than just catching a train—it's connecting with the vibrant network of regional and intercity transit options. While the station itself lacks advanced travel services, including direct bus or cycle hire facilities, a rail replacement bus stop is conveniently located at the station entrance during service disruptions. This ensures connectivity isn't hindered in the case of unexpected rail works.

Facilities and Amenities

Although the station lacks a traditional ticket office, it compensates with user-friendly ticket machines, which also facilitate the collection of tickets purchased online. These machines are equipped with touchscreen technology and accessible features to cater to passengers with varying needs.

Step-free access is available throughout the station, which makes it exceptionally convenient for individuals with mobility challenges. Moreover, the station has ramps for easier train access, proving its commitment to inclusivity. While there is no luggage storage or waiting room available, seating areas are provided for those waiting for their train connections.

For your wellbeing, Llanhilleth Station is monitored by CCTV cameras, ensuring passenger safety. Although there aren't any shops, ATMs, or refreshment facilities, its primary focus is efficient travel. Those requiring assistance can rely on help points found on-site. Reliable customer service can also be accessed through the Transport for Wales website.

Onward Travel Options

Llanhilleth Station is thoroughly connected to a web of transportation links. Rail replacement services, when necessary, operate from a bus stop on Commercial Road, conveniently located at the junction of the station access road. Although there are no cycle hire facilities on station premises, bike storage is provided for those commuting by bicycle.
